Linked list C

Tags:    c

Hej igen folk.

Har nogenlunde fået min egen malloc og free funktion til at virke:
Fold kodeboks ind/udC kode 


Det skal siges at headersize = const uint64_t headerSize = sizeof(struct Node)

og min struct se således ud:
Fold kodeboks ind/udC kode 


Der er altså tale om en linked list. Når jeg kører mit testprogram, rammer jeg ikke helt præcist.. Kan i fortælle mig hvor det går galt?

Som bonus info, så er programmet en del af et større program, som skal håndtere processer. Der oprettes først 1 process, som derefter kalder to andre. Disse processer er opbygget som en dobbelt linked list.


Output ser indtil videre sådan her ud:
http://s8.postimg.org/bc1wnvvz9/output.png

på forhånd tak.



1 svar postet i denne tråd vises herunder
0 indlæg har modtaget i alt 0 karma
Sorter efter stemmer Sorter efter dato
Hvis du laver et standalone program, som crasher, og poster koden her, så skal jeg gerne tage et kig.



t